DESCRIPTION:On January 27th\, the San Jose City Council will vote on changes to the Inclusionary Housing Ordinance (IHO)\, the Mobilehome Rent Ordinance (MRO)\, and the extension of two housing incentive programs. Each of these proposals\, in one way or another\, worsen our housing and affordability crises by gutting affordable housing development\, removing tenant protections\, and providing subsidies for market-rate developers without any public benefit. \nJoin us to make public comment opposing these positions. \nMeeting begins at 1:30 pm\, with the MRO not being heard until 6pm.
